Weather and Climate

Nice, being a Mediterranean city, has a mild climate throughout the year. The average temperature ranges from 12°C (54°F) in January (the coldest month) to 24°C (75°F) in July and August (the warmest months). The city experiences a moderate amount of rainfall, with an average of 767 mm (30.1 in) of rainfall annually.

    Events and Festivals in Nice and Monaco

    Both Nice and Monaco host various events and festivals throughout the year, which can be a great way to experience the local culture and atmosphere.

    Nice Carnival (February to March)

    The Nice Carnival is one of the most famous carnivals in the world, attracting millions of visitors each year. The carnival features colorful parades, floats, and costumes, as well as live music and dancing.

    Nice Jazz Festival (July)

    Nice Jazz Festival is a popular event that takes place in July, featuring some of the world’s top jazz musicians. The festival is held in the Cimiez Amphitheater, which offers stunning views of the city. (See Also: Best Time to Visit Alamo – Peak Season Secrets)

    Monaco Grand Prix (May)

    The Monaco Grand Prix is one of the most prestigious Formula One races in the world, attracting millions of visitors each year. The race is held on the Circuit de Monaco, which winds its way through the city’s streets.

    Monaco Yacht Show (September)

    The Monaco Yacht Show is one of the most luxurious yacht exhibitions in the world, featuring some of the most expensive and exclusive yachts in the world. The show is held in the Port Hercules, which offers stunning views of the city.
